Miri vs Joensuu Climate & Distance Between

Finland flag
  • The distance between Miri, Malaysia and Joensuu, Finland is approximately 9,291 km or 5,774 mi.
  • To reach Miri in this distance one would set out from Joensuu bearing 93°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Miri bearing 152.6° or SSE .
  • Miri has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Joensuu has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
  • The annual mean temperature is 24.4 °C (43.9°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 26.2 °C (47.2°F) less in Miri.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 2210.7 mm (87 in) more which is equivalent to 2210.7 l/m² (54.26 US gal/ft²) or 22,107,000 l/ha (2,363,385 US gal/ac) more. About 4 3/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 47.1° higher in Miri than in Joensuu.
